Board reference page. Net headcount target: +34, weighted toward engineering at the Ostbrook site. Support functions flat. Two roles backfilled only on attrition. Hiring freeze in the Calder unit pending the product decision. Promotion budget capped at last year's level. Contractors convert only where roles are clearly permanent. Timeline: approvals by end of month, requisitions open the following week. Do not circulate beyond this page's access list. The confidential planning note sits below.

confidential, kagup-bafog: Fraaxax Group is in early talks to buy Soroxox Group for about $343.8 million. The Olidor launch date is June 14, and nothing goes to the press before then. Legal wants the Aldmirek Logistics term sheet signed before July 23.

Quick note before the sync: I reworked the layout pass in Graphlet so cyclic clusters don't explode into spaghetti anymore. The force-directed step now caps iterations per frame, which fixed the jank Tamsin flagged on the Vexbridge monorepo. One caveat — edge bundling is sensitive to the repulsion scalar, so don't tweak it casually. The current tuning values are as follows.

tuning table, kajog-kawef:
PRIORITIES = {
    "kelox": 870,
    "kasix": 89,
    "eliax": 988,
}

Changelog: Gateway Rate Limiting (Corvane Internal APIs)

The setting GATEWAY_THROTTLE_MAX has been renamed to RATE_LIMIT_CEILING as of release 4.2. Behavior is unchanged; only the name differs. Support: if a team reports 429s after upgrading, check that their env file uses the new name. The rate-limit service now also verifies callers with a shared credential, so the updated env file should include this line.

sealed setting: RELAY_SECRET5=82864

## ResizeKit CLI — limits and quotas

If you're on call and someone pages about stuck resize batches, it's almost always a quota thing. ResizeKit caps concurrent workers per host, total pixels per job, and queue depth per tenant, and it refuses anything past those rather than degrading quietly. Bumping a limit is fine for a one-off, but revert it after — the Quillmark render farm falls over otherwise. The enforced defaults are the following.

tuning constants:
RATE_LIMITS = {
    "wenwyn": 1,
    "zorix": 10,
    "oliix": 2,
    "holael": 10,
}